Key Points

  • Always find out the manufacturer and model of a computer first. Some manufacturers change default Windows settings, include modified help files, and install custom diagnostics software.

  • Always try one possible solution at a time. If the solution does not work, undo the solution before moving on to the next. This takes extra time but helps ensure the stability of the user’s system and gives you a better idea of what worked and what did not.

Key Terms

basic input/output system (BIOS) A computer’s BIOS program determines in what order the computer searches for system files on boot up, manages communication between the operating system and the attached devices on boot up, and is an integral part of the computer.

device driver Software that is used to allow a computer and a piece of hardware to communicate. Device drivers that are incompatible, corrupt, outdated, or of the wrong version for the hardware can cause errors that are difficult to diagnose.

Internet cache files A temporary copy of the text and graphics for all the Web pages that a user has visited. These temporary files are stored in random access memory (RAM) and on your hard disk and can be accessed more quickly than retrieving the files fresh from the Internet every time you visit the page. Internet cache files make browsing the Internet faster because pages you visit often can be loaded more quickly than they can if no cache files exist.
